Most patients report minimal to no sensation when administering tirzepatide injections, though individual needle sensitivity varies. Tirzepatide is delivered via subcutaneous injection once weekly, using a very fine gauge needle—typically 31-gauge—that penetrates only the fatty tissue layer beneath the skin.
Understanding what to expect during injection can reduce anxiety, improve technique, and support consistent dosing. Needle Gauge and Injection Depth: Why Sensation Varies
Tirzepatide injection needles are significantly thinner than insulin syringes or blood draw needles. The 31-gauge needle creates minimal tissue trauma, and the injection depth—typically 0.5 inches into subcutaneous fat—avoids nerve-rich dermal layers, explaining why most users experience little to no pain.
Injection site location influences sensation. Abdomen, thigh, and upper arm subcutaneous tissue contains fewer pain receptors than skin. Rotating injection sites not only prevents lipohypertrophy but also distributes needle sensation across areas with varying sensitivity, which can be documented with your healthcare provider.
Preparation, Temperature, and Technique: Clinical Factors Affecting Comfort
Multiple evidence-based practices reduce injection discomfort. Allowing compounded tirzepatide to reach room temperature (versus cold storage) decreases tissue irritation. Waiting 30 seconds after cleaning the injection site with alcohol allows the skin to dry completely, reducing sting sensation during needle insertion.
| Preparation Factor |
Impact on Injection Comfort |
| Medication temperature |
Room temperature reduces tissue irritation and burning sensation |
| Needle gauge (31G vs 29G) |
Thinner gauge = less tissue trauma and minimal pain |
| Injection speed |
Slow delivery (over 5 seconds) prevents pressure buildup in tissue |
| Skin preparation (alcohol drying) |
Prevents stinging; allows evaporation before needle insertion |
| Injection site rotation |
Avoids lipohypertrophy and distributes needle trauma across areas |
Individual Sensitivity Patterns and Needle Anxiety
Needle sensitivity exists on a spectrum. Some patients report absolute absence of sensation; others experience brief, mild pressure. Anxiety anticipating the injection can amplify perceived discomfort more than the needle itself. Evidence supports grounding techniques, focused breathing, and familiarization with the injection process to reduce anxiety-driven sensation.
Prior experience with self-administered medications (insulin, biologics) typically correlates with lower needle anxiety. If you have significant needle phobia, inform your healthcare provider before starting tirzepatide—alternative counseling or slower titration schedules can support comfort and adherence over time.
Who Tirzepatide Is Appropriate For and Important Safety Considerations
Tirzepatide is indicated for adults with type 2 diabetes or obesity when prescribed by a qualified healthcare provider. It is not appropriate for pregnant or breastfeeding patients, those with personal or family history of medullary thyroid carcinoma, or multiple endocrine neoplasia syndrome type 2. Your provider must evaluate your full medical history before initiation.
Compounded tirzepatide from licensed 503A pharmacies offers dosing flexibility and accessibility compared to branded formulations, but compounded medications are not FDA-approved and should only be used under direct provider supervision. Starting with low doses and titrating gradually—as your provider directs—allows your body to adapt and reduces potential side effects including nausea and injection-site reactions.
